Drakman commands the rebel group Orange Amusements against the governing E=X Bureau in Megazone 23 Part III. He orchestrates network-based insurgency from a hidden Eden headquarters, driven by a desire to dismantle what he sees as E=X's oppressive control, utilizing manipulative and exploitative tactics. He recruits hackers and netjackers, including the gamer Bud, whom he later forces via invasive cybernetic implants to pilot a Hargan III combat mecha, sacrificing followers for strategic advantage. Drakman distrusts spiritual leader Bishop Won Dai, dismissing rumors of his ancient origins as ridiculous and suggesting he might be a computer-generated illusion like Eve. Learning of E=X's classified Project Heaven—a plan to launch Eden into space—Drakman orders Edval to steal its data, aiming to sabotage the project. He attempts a military coup, directing cybernetically controlled Hargan units to attack E=X Tower while framing Sion's Orange faction to conceal his involvement. Drakman rejects Sion's proposal to broadcast Project Heaven data to citizens, insisting only a suicidal charge is viable, prioritizing brute force over ideology. His rebellion collapses when E=X commander Yacob destroys the Hargan forces, including Bud's unit. Drakman's actions following this defeat remain undocumented.
